ScraperAI is a Chrome extension that helps users extract structured data from webpages in their browser.
This Privacy Policy explains what information ScraperAI processes, what is stored locally, and what is sent to external services for Pro license activation.

Webpage Data Processing
When you click the scan or export buttons, ScraperAI analyzes the current webpage in your browser to detect product cards, tables, lists, and repeated content sections.
The extracted data is processed locally in your browser and can be exported by you to CSV, Excel-compatible XLS, or JSON files.
Scraped webpage content is not transmitted to ScraperAI servers.

Pro License Activation
If you activate ScraperAI Pro, the extension sends the following information to our license server:
- Your License Key
- A browser installation identifier
The license server forwards the request to Creem to verify whether the License Key is valid and can be activated.
Scraped webpage data is never sent during license activation.
Third-Party Services
ScraperAI uses Creem for payment processing and license key management.
Creem may process payment, order, customer, and license information according to its own terms and privacy policy.
ScraperAI uses Cloudflare Workers to proxy license activation requests securely so that Creem API keys are not exposed inside the Chrome extension.
